The Tire and Rubber Association of Canada (TRAC) announced changes to its Board of Directors on Tuesday, following the resignations of Antoine Sautenet of Michelin North America (Canada) Inc and Matt Livigni of Continental Tire Canada Inc. TRAC claims that Andrew Mutch of Michelin North America (Canada) Inc and Kim Rolfe of Continental Tire Canada Inc have been appointed as Directors, to complete the expired terms of Sautenet and Livigni, respectively.

Additionally, Pam Scarrow of Bridgestone, Chris Figel of AirBoss, and Rolfe have taken on new officer roles as first and second Vice-Chairmen, and Treasurer, respectively.

Sharing his thoughts on Sautenet’s and Livigni’s exits, Paul Downey, President and CEO of Pliteq, and Chairman of the Board, TRAC, said, “Antoine and Matt have served with distinction as TRAC’s first Vice-Chairman and Treasurer, respectively. We are grateful for their leadership and dedication, and wish them both well in their new roles in France and South Africa, respectively.”

Downey went on to add, “Additionally, the Board of Directors would like to welcome Messrs Mutch and Rolfe to the TRAC Board. We look forward to their expertise and support in advancing TRAC’s mission, vision and strategic priorities.”

According to TRAC, Mutch, President of Michelin’s Canadian operations, has over 30 years of experience working at all three Michelin's factories in Nova Scotia, as well as company facilities in Oklahoma and South Carolina. He has held roles in industrial engineering, manufacturing management, human resources, and strategic planning and investments.

As for Rolfe, Controller and Assistant Treasurer of Continental Tire Canada, he has over 27 years of experience working in various positions in the United States, Germany and Canada. He has held roles in auditing, corporate accounting, plant and sales office controlling, as per TRAC. Plus, he has participated in many projects, ranging from administrative/manufacturing benchmarking to management information system development to M&A to operational start-ups.

    Bridgestone will supply tailored-made tyres for Lamborghini’s Huracán STO, which will be launched in 2021.

    Bridgestone ensured the high-performance tyre can maximise the Huracán STO’s traction, handling, control, and extreme overall performance.

    Key to the tyre’s success in maximising the super sports car’s performance is the combination of pattern and cavity design. The Potenza tyres apply an asymmetric tread design for enhanced steering response and cornering stability, and an internal crown structure that distributes footprint pressure evenly when cornering.

    As well as the road-focused, custom-developed Potenza fitment, Bridgestone will also be providing a track-oriented, road-homologated version of the tyre that applies “race” technologies to maximise the vehicle’s track performance, especially in dry conditions.

      Hankook, one of the major global tyre brands, has started testing and development operations at its new ultra modern facility in Spain.

      The testing facility has been set up on the premises of the Applus+ IDIADA Group and can also cater to European premium car manufacturers that have their own demanding tyre tests. The facility is completely automated and will host a 20-member team from the Spanish testing centre, which is affiliated to the Hankook Europe Technical Centre.

        ASCENSO introduced a construction tyre - BLB 730- which is used for boom lift vehicles used in construction and other industries. It comes with several features that cater to the unique needs of aerial lifting equipment.

        The BLB 730 tyre is available in different sizes to fit various boom lift vehicles. This range of sizes provides versatility and compatibility with different types of aerial lift work platforms.

        ASCENSO's BLB 730 tyre is a significant advancement in specialised equipment for the construction industry. It focuses on load capacity, stability, traction, and durability to improve the performance and safety of boom lift vehicles. Whether working at heights or manoeuvring on tough terrains, this tyre offers reliability and durability for efficient operations,” said the company in a statement.

        The BLB 730 tyre is built to handle heavy loads and stabilise boom lift vehicles. It has solid lugs and a more extended shoulder design, which ensures good traction and prevents slipping during operation. This is important for safely carrying heavy weights at high elevations. ASCENSO has used a special rubber compound in making the BLB 730 tyre, making it durable and long-lasting, resulting in less downtime and more productivity on construction sites.

        To make the tyre even better, the company has optimised its inner volume to reduce tyre fill consumption, reducing the risk of tyre punctures, minimising the need for maintenance, and keep the vehicles running smoothly.

          Falken Tyre Europe is an official IHF Men's World Championship 2023 partner for the upcoming tournament, the company has announced. The tournament is taking place at nine venues in Sweden and Poland from 11-29 January, 2023. Falken Tyre claims that the partnership was organised by the sports marketing agency SPORTFIVE. SPORTFIVE is responsible for exclusive marketing and media rights for all IHF World Championships until 2031.

          Falken Tyre claims that this is its second agreement with the International Handball Federation. In addition to title and logo rights (Official IHF Men's World Championship 2023 Partner), the company has also secured advertising rights, including the Falken logo in each goal and centre circle of the courts, as well as the presence of Falken branding in the official tournament social media communications and print materials. According to Falken Tyre, this is complemented by 30-second video ads that will be shown on the big screens in the nine sports halls before the start of each match and at half-time.
